Dudu and EPP Film on Israeli News Show

I was very happy to hear a few weeks back that EPP team member and one of the main stars of our film - Everest: A Climb for Peace was going to be on one of the most prestigious  news shows in Israel regarding relevant and important events. It indeed happened recently and it was a very successful interview.

Dudu Yifrah was on the talk show "Roim Olam" - which in English means "Viewing the World". The show is considered to be Israel's no. 1 program for foreign affairs and is highly respected and rated. This is a weekly show that has aired each Saturday for almost 20 years now.

Dudu talked about our historic climb and our history-making Everest film and his role in the expedition. Dudu in an incredible act of friendship and peace unfolded a sewn-together Palestinian and Israeli flag on the summit of Mt. Everest.

The interview was about 11 minutes long and also included a few clips of our film.
